<ins dir="qlwv"></ins>

TP钱包与imToken深度解析:实时数据、合约模拟、预言机与数字认证的比较与实践建议

引言

本文面向开发者与高级用户,系统比较并讲解两款主流非托管移动/多端钱包——TP钱包(TokenPocket)与 imToken。重点覆盖它们在实时数据处理、合约模拟、专家分析报告、新兴市场服务、预言机接入与数字身份认证等方面的能力、实现方式与风险控制建议。

一、产品概览

TP钱包:多链中立,覆盖以太坊、BSC、Solana、Tron、HECO 等链,强调 DApp 浏览器与跨链互操作。支持钱包导入、硬件/助记词、DApp 聚合、内置 Swap 聚合器与跨链桥。

imToken:起源于以太坊生态,后扩展到多链。以安全与生态服务著称,提供 imKey 硬件、内置 Tokenlon 去中心化交易与通用钱包功能,强调用户身份与更严谨的合约交互提示。

二、实时数据处理

- 数据源与节点:两者均采用自建节点池、第三方 RPC(Infura、Alchemy 或自营)与 Indexer 服务。为保证延迟与可用性,通常使用多节点轮询、自动切换与健康检测。

- 推送与订阅:通过 WebSocket、gRPC 或长轮询实现交易状态、余额变动与事件推送。移动端通过本地消息队列合并更新,避免频繁唤醒导致电量消耗。

- 缓存与一致性:前端采用分层缓存(本地 DB + 内存)与乐观更新;对 nonce、pending tx、手续费波动需做纠正逻辑,防止界面误导用户。

三、合约模拟(Transaction Simulation)

- 基本实现:在提交交易前调用 RPC 的 eth_call(或等价方法)做只读模拟,estimateGas 估算并捕获 revert 原因。高级钱包会将合约调用数据发送到模拟服务(本地或云端)在私有 EVM 实例中执行,以获取更精确的返回值与状态变化预览。

- 演示与安全提示:合约模拟可以展示 token 变动、授权影响及潜在重入/失败路径;若集成源码或 ABI,可进行输入校验与函数级别提示。

- 风险与限制:模拟不等于完全安全,链上状态变动、MEV、时间依赖或外部合约回调可能导致实际执行与模拟结果不同。钱包应在 UI 中明确说明模拟局限性。

四、专家分析报告与风控评分

- 功能形式:基于链上数据、合约审计历史、代币分布、流动性深度、合约源代码验证与漏洞数据库,生成风险评分与可读分析报告。

- 数据来源:借助 on-chain analytics(The Graph、自建索引)、审计厂商结果、社区情报与安全预警网络。

- 应用场景:新代币上架提示、授权额度建议、可疑合约警告、交易前的“红旗”标注。

五、新兴市场服务策略

- 本地化与支付通道:为满足非洲、东南亚等区域,钱包需要集成本地法币支付、代理商渠道、P2P 兑换与弱网适配(低带宽、离线签名、USSD/短信引导)等。

- 产品层面:提供小额手续费优惠、教育引导(操作风险、备份助记词)、低门槛链上身份与 KYC 可选方案以促活用户。

六、预言机(Oracles)在钱包中的角色

- 价格与链外数据:钱包显示的价格、滑点计算与某些 DApp 的交易前校验依赖预言机。主流集成包括 Chainlink、Band 或自研聚合器。

- 可信度与安全:钱包在显示价格或进行自动化策略(如限价、一次性兑换)时应注明数据来源与更新时间,并支持多源比对以降低单点被操控风险。

七、数字认证与身份(Wallet as Identity)

- 签名认证:钱包通过用户签名实现登录(SIWE 等)、授权与身份验证,取代传统账号密码。

- DID 与凭证:结合去中心化身份(DID)与可验证凭证,钱包可承载用户资质、职能证明与 KYC 断言,同时保留隐私选择权。

- 管理建议:鼓励分层身份策略(匿名钱包、通用身份、受信钱包),对高价值操作加入多签或硬件签名链路。

八、对比结论与建议

- 适用场景:想要广泛多链接入与 DApp 体验的用户可偏向 TP;重视审计、合规与安全硬件生态的用户可选择 imToken;但两者功能重合,最终取决于节点稳定性、用户本地化服务与生态合作伙伴。

- 最佳实践:备份助记词、优先使用硬件签名、大额操作启用多签、在钱包内审查合约 ABI、利用合约模拟与专家报告降低风险、核查预言机来源并限制无限制授权。

结语

TP 与 imToken 都是成熟的非托管钱包解决方案,各自在多链支持、生态合作与安全工具上有所侧重。对技术团队与高端用户而言,理解实时数据管道、合约模拟能力与预言机可信度,是降低链上操作风险与提升用户体验的关键。

作者:孙立晨发布时间:2025-10-12 18:32:21

评论

小明

写得很全面,尤其是合约模拟与预言机的风险描述,很实用。

CryptoLisa

想知道两款钱包在硬件钱包支持上的差异,能否补充具体型号和接入流程?

链闻者

新兴市场章节很契合实际,希望能有更多关于弱网适配的技术细节。

TomWu

对于普通用户,最实用的建议还是备份助记词与启用硬件签名,文章提醒到位。

相关阅读
<sub dropzone="bvunn"></sub><b dir="atjs9"></b><bdo lang="g3rsx"></bdo><tt lang="39ku8"></tt>
<area lang="ctyy2pc"></area><kbd dir="8p1szks"></kbd><em dir="p9upswz"></em>
<bdo draggable="6_ya_x"></bdo><legend dir="d451pa"></legend><strong date-time="mcn5wl"></strong>